| An issue was discovered in the Mail Disguise module before 1.x-1.0.5 for Backdrop CMS. It enables a website to obfuscate email addresses, and should prevent spambots from collecting them. The module doesn't sufficiently validate the data attribute value on links, potentially leading to a Cross Site Scripting (XSS) vulnerability. This is mitigated by the fact an attacker must be able to insert link (<a>) HTML elements containing data attributes into the page. |

| A vulnerability in the file upload at bookmark + asset rendering pipeline allows an attacker to upload a malicious SVG file with JavaScript content. When an authenticated admin user views the SVG file with embedded JavaScript code of shared bookmark, JavaScript executes in the admin’s browser, retrieves the CSRF token, and sends a request to change the admin's password resulting in a full account takeover. |
